Abstract
The dipole magnetization of a heavy spherical nucleus is studied with macroscopic standpoint. The semiclassical model under consideration fo cuses on the giant M1 resonance as a result of long wavelength oscilla tions of the collective magnetization current induced in the surface m assive layer of finite depth. The macroscopic picture of the excited c ollective how is found to be like that for the torsional elastic vibra tions of the peripheral layer against the central spherical region ine rt with respect to external perturbation. The emphasis is placed on ca lculation of scaling behavior integral characteristic parameters of ma gnetic dipole resonance.
